Understanding the 4Cs of Diamonds

The attraction of Diamond usually starts with an understanding of the 4Cs: cut, carat, quality, and color weight. Each of these attributes plays a necessary role in establishing a diamond's total beauty and worth. The cut describes exactly how well the Diamond has been shaped and faceted, impacting its radiance and shimmer (jewelry gifts). Shade examines the absence of shade in a diamond, with one of the most prized stones being colorless or near-colorless. Clarity measures the visibility of internal or external defects, called imperfections and incorporations, specifically; greater clarity qualities indicate a more beautiful stone. Carat weight signifies the dimension of the Diamond, with larger stones typically commanding higher costs. Understanding these 4Cs empowers customers to make educated decisions, guaranteeing they pick a ruby that not just fulfills their aesthetic choices but additionally straightens with their monetary considerations and investment objectives

Choosing the Right Cut for Your Style

Picking the right cut for a ruby is crucial in revealing personal style and enhancing the stone's natural appeal. Each cut has special qualities that can influence the general appearance of the precious jewelry. For example, the timeless round dazzling cut makes the most of sparkle and is a preferred selection for interaction rings, attracting conventional tastes. On the other hand, the princess cut, with its contemporary angular shape, satisfies those seeking a contemporary flair.

Other alternatives consist of the oval and pear cuts that use a touch of sophistication while lengthening the finger. The padding cut combines classic charm with a romantic touch, attracting those who appreciate a classic visual. Ultimately, the right cut should reverberate with individual choices, whether one prefers vibrant statements or timeless styles. By thoroughly thinking about the cut, people can select Diamond fashion jewelry that lines up completely with their unique style and character.

Discovering Diamond Colors and Their Importance

Color plays a vital duty in the general charm of Diamond jewelry, influencing both its visual and value. fine jewelry South Africa. Diamond are rated on a scale from D (colorless) to Z (light yellow or brown), with anemic Diamond generally holding the highest possible worth. Colorless rocks show light wonderfully, developing a dazzling shimmer that appeals to lots of customers. However, elegant tinted Diamond, such as pink, blue, or yellow, have actually gotten popularity for their originality and rarity, often commanding higher prices out there

The significance of shade expands beyond plain visual allure; it can represent individual design and psychological connection. For example, blue Diamond symbolize serenity, while yellow Diamond evoke warmth and pleasure. When selecting Diamond precious jewelry, comprehending the shade range is vital for making a notified choice that aligns with one's preference and objective. Inevitably, the ideal color can improve the beauty of the precious jewelry item and produce an enduring impression.

Popular Establishing Designs

Picking the excellent setup for Diamond jewelry can greatly influence both its appearance and the wearer's personal style. Popular setting designs include the classic solitaire, which highlights a single Diamond for ageless elegance. The halo setting features a main rock surrounded by smaller sized Diamond, boosting brilliance and size perception. The three-stone setup symbolizes the past, existing, and future, making it a purposeful choice for lots of. On the other hand, the lead setup, embellished with tiny Diamond along the band, adds a shimmering effect. For those looking for a contemporary twist, the stress setup puts on hold the Diamond between two ends of the band, developing a striking aesthetic. Each style provides unique characteristics, allowing people to share their individuality while showcasing the Diamond's appeal.

The choice of steel for Diamond fashion jewelry is essential, as it not just impacts the overall appearances but likewise influences toughness and maintenance. Popular choices consist of white gold, yellow gold, increased gold, and platinum. White gold supplies a contemporary, streamlined look, matching the luster of Diamond while being much more inexpensive than platinum. Yellow gold shows traditional heat and luxury, whereas rose gold gives an enchanting, vintage touch. Platinum, recognized for its toughness and hypoallergenic buildings, is excellent for everyday wear however comes with a greater price. Each steel has unique care demands; for circumstances, white gold might require routine re-plating. Ultimately, the selection ought to show individual design and way of living needs, making sure both beauty and practicality in the selected piece.

Exactly How Can I Inform if a Ruby Is Fairly Sourced?

To figure out if a ruby is morally sourced, one need to look for certifications from trustworthy companies, ask about the supply chain openness, and look for tags such as "conflict-free" or "sensibly sourced" from relied on jewelry experts.

What Is the Finest Method to Clean Diamond Fashion Jewelry?

To clean Diamond fashion jewelry, one need to use a mixture of warm water and moderate dish soap. Carefully scrub with a soft brush, rinse extensively, and dry with a lint-free cloth to recover its sparkle.

Exactly how Should I Shop My Diamond Jewelry?

To store Diamond jewelry, one must maintain pieces in a soft, separate fabric or bag to stop scrapes - diamond jewelry collection. A designated jewelry box with areas is optimal for organization and protection versus dust and damages

Can I Resize My Diamond Ring Later On?



Yes, a diamond ring can be resized later on. Nonetheless, the procedure may depend upon the ring's design and materials. It is recommended to get in touch with an expert jewelry expert for the best resizing methods and alternatives.

What Insurance Choices Are Readily Available for Diamond Fashion Jewelry?

Numerous insurance choices exist for Diamond jewelry, including specialized precious jewelry insurance coverage, homeowners or tenants insurance coverage plans, and individual articles policies. Each choice uses various coverage levels, making certain defense against damage, burglary, or loss.
